## v4.8.0 — Renamed skew setting

`BUILDNET_MAX_DRIFT` is now `BUILDNET_CLOCK_SKEW_MS`. The old name is ignored as of this release — agents on Torvik pool will fail handshake if skew exceeds the new default of 1500ms. Update every agent's `.env` before redeploying; do not rely on the migration shim. On-call: after renaming the variable, insert the agent signing secret directly below this line.

secret setting of fawep-tagaf: ARCHIVE_KEY3=ce5

# Sproutly Env Vars (on-call notes)

Hey on-call — Sproutly, our plant-watering scheduler, reads everything from .env at boot. WATER_INTERVAL_MIN and PUMP_TIMEOUT_SEC are safe to tweak live; the scheduler hot-reloads them. The valve-controller API credential is not hot-reloaded, so a restart is required after changing it. If watering jobs are silently failing, nine times out of ten it's that credential. Check that the file contains the following line.

secret setting of kawip-tajop: RELAY_SECRET8=11ecb20c

## Step 2: Pin planner settings

The Varroway 5.2 upgrade regressed the query planner; several Dunmoor reporting queries fell back to sequential scans. Mitigation: pin planner flags at the service level until 5.3 lands. Security note — the override file is world-readable by default, so fix permissions first. Apply the following values to each replica.

service settings:
PRAIX_LOG_LEVEL=error
PRAIX_METRICS_HOST=metrics.praix.qorvelcorp.corp
PRAIX_POOL_SIZE=16

Ticket #4412 — FX rounding drift blocked by expired creds

Hey, quick one before the cut: the Lumenrate conversion job has been piling up half-cent rounding errors again, and we can't rerun the reconciliation pass because the service credential for Coinforge expired over the weekend. Marta regenerated it this morning, so the fix can ship with tonight's release. For the deploy checklist, use the fresh key below when wiring up the reconciler.

app token of tagef-tafog = qvz3-7n0